USER MANUAL BTCLS-DISP JUNG
Operating instructions

Description of device
The JUNG Bluetooth Connect BTC... consists of an operating cover and a flush-mounted power supply. The audio source (e.g. smartphone or MP3 player) is connected and the device is operated via the operating cover. The device is operated and set up via 8 sensor buttons.
The connections for mains voltage, loudspeakers and audio output are available on the power supply unit. The Bluetooth Connect can be operated with one or two loudspeaker modules LSM...
The music signal is transmitted via Bluetooth, amplified internally and output to loudspeakers or an external amplifier. The tracks and volume can be changed via sensor buttons. Up to 6 audio sources can be taught in, from which one audio source can be connected actively with the Bluetooth Connect.

Operation
The lower half of the cover is used for operation. All operations are made via 8 sensor buttons. In standby mode the buttons are hidden and are displayed each time you touch the lower area.

Switching on / Switching off
The Bluetooth Connect is switched on and off here (standby).
Note: After switching on, the Bluetooth Connect connects automatically to the last audio source if it can be reached. If the source is not available, e.g. because it is not within range, the next audio source is connected. The Bluetooth Connect attempts to reach the taught-in audio sources in the sequence they were taught in.
While searching for the connection, the button illumination dims brighter and darker. The playback starts automatically depending on the device type / device software.

Adjusting the volume
The volume is adjusted using the buttons. The Bluetooth Connect always starts with the volume that was last adjusted.

Teaching in the audio source
With a press of a button, the Bluetooth Connect switches to the learn mode and is then visible for a maximum of 30 seconds for audio players with an integrated Bluetooth interface (e.g. smartphone or MP3 player). A connection can now be established via such a device and it can be taught in on the Bluetooth Connect.
Note: During the 30 seconds, the buttons will flash until the connection has been established.
In some operating systems, a device that has previously been taught-in can only be taught-in again if the existing connection was deleted in this device.

Selecting the audio source
With a long press of a button (>2 s) the connection to the next taught-in and accessible audio source is established. Afterwards, the playback is started. The search is indicated by dimming the button illumination brighter and darker. This procedure can last up to 40 seconds depending on the number of the taught-in devices.

Selecting a track
The last/next track can be selected by a brief press of a button. The track sequence corresponds to the order of the audio source. The sequence can normally be defined there according to albums, artists, genre or playlists.

Pause
With a press of a button, the playback of the connected audio source is interrupted.

Deleting connections
With a long press of a button (>10 s), all previously taught-in audio sources are deleted from the Bluetooth Connect.

Installation

The Bluetooth Connect BTC... has been designed for installation in device boxes DIN EN 49073.
The connections for mains voltage, loudspeakers and the audio output are located on the flush-mounted power supply unit. The operating cover together with the frame are mounted onto the power supply unit.
Netzanschluss

The Bluetooth Connect requires a permanent mains connection. A loopthrough via the connecting terminals is not permitted.
Before carrying out work on the device, disengage all the corresponding circuit breakers. Cover up live parts in the working environment. Within the device box, all the cables carrying low voltages must have an insulating hose in order to guarantee protective separation.
Connecting an extension unit

The extension unit connection (1) is used to switch the Bluetooth Connect on/off via switches, e.g. together with the light. The extension unit input may only be operated on the same phase.
Before carrying out work on the device, disengage all the corresponding circuit breakers. Cover up live parts in the working environment. Within the device box, all the cables carrying low voltages must have an insulating hose in order to guarantee protective separation.
Connecting a loudspeaker

The device is intended for operation with one or two loudspeaker modules LSM... The connection cable can be up to 5 m long.
In stereo mode, both outputs (L+R) are used. The device detects autonomously if only one loudspeaker is used and then changes its operating mode to mono.
The connection of several loudspeakers per output is not permitted.
Loudspeakers of other manufacturers may only be used if the technical data is identical with the JUNG LSM....
Please observe the polarity.
Mono/Stereo change-over
If two loudspeakers are to be operated in mono, e.g. in separate rooms, it is possible to change over by pressing both buttons simultaneously for 10 seconds. The new mode is indicated by tones. One tone corresponds to the mono mode, and two tones correspond to the stereo mode.
Line-out (AUX)
The Line-out (AUX) is used for connecting to an external amplifier or to the JUNG Smart Radio RAD...

Technical data
Rated voltage: AC 230 V \~
Frequency: 50/60 Hz
Power consumption in standby: 0.37 W
Power consumption in operation: < 4.00 W
Ambient temperature: 0...+50 °C
Atmospheric humidity: 15% ... 90%
no condensation
Bluetooth: A2DP, AVRCP
Degree of protection: IP 20
Connection: Screw terminals
1 x 1.5 mm² or 1 x 2.5 mm²
Connecting cable loudspeaker:
Twin cable H03VH-H, 2 x 0.75 mm²
alternative:
JY-(St)- Y 2x2x0.6
Length: max. 5 m
Loudspeaker LSM...:
Rated load capacity: 2.5 W
Impedance: 4 Ω
Frequency range: 20 ... 15000 Hz (-10 dB)
Line-out (AUX):
Impedance: 470 Ω
Output level: 1 V
